WILL OSPREAY
(In Japanese)"I am Will Ospreay from New Japan Pro Wrestling, the IWGP UK Heavyweight Champion. Did you have fun? (English) It was truly a dream come true, I was able to compete against Marufuji, who has been my hero since I was 16 years old. I really, really love Japanese professional wrestling, and I am very grateful to the people at the Noah office who made this opportunity possible, as well as to all the Noah fans who welcomed me. I've had a very busy schedule after competing in the G1, and I'm exhausted, I went to America, England, America again, went back to England, and then finally to make my dream come true, returned to Japan to have this important match. Today the match happened, and my dream came true. I honestly feel that I have no choice but to thank everyone. Me and Eddie Kingston have somewhat similar histories, but it might be interesting for Akiyama and Eddie Kingston and myself and Marufuji to team up and have a match. That's how much Eddie Kingston and I love Japanese professional wrestling, and we think that Japanese professional wrestling is the best. Now, the next step is to defend this belt against Tsuji*, I will do my best.

*Yota Tsuji. Kaito Kiyomiya's G1 nemesis. 

NAOMICHI MARUFUJI

MARUFUJI: Thank you.
Q: How did you feel about fighting Ospreay?
MARUFUJI: He's truly a genius. Wrestlers like that are called geniuses, right? People say that about me, but I'm not like that at all. And, isn't this the perfect version of modern professional wrestling? It's scary because he doesn't think he's perfected it. Well, it was wonderful, frustrating, but wonderful, and it felt good.
Q: What was it like to see the reaction of the overpacked crowd?
MARUFUJI: Over the years, I have realized the importance of each and every ticket, and the fact that the fans showed their support in the form of a sold out event showed that there is potential in professional wrestling, and the question is how well can we convey that potential to the world? We have a lot of good wrestlers, and we have a lot of good matches, but we just don't get that across. I just happened to be able to convey the message a little better than them, which is how things turned out today, but if each of us could do this, the venues would always be overcrowded, and even the Budokan or the Dome would not be a dream. I'm not saying this to be cool, but I think that by doing so, and each one of us being aware of this, will lead to the development of Noah. So I'll work hard from now on and since I lost today, I'll work hard and make everything perfect. If that were true then I would have beaten Jake Lee, won the belt, enter the N-1 and won it, and gotten to this day, beaten him, and then there would have been nothing more to say about my pro wrestling career as it would be over. But then I might have retired, so in the end it was a good thing. I'm glad I came back alive, because there are so many incredible techniques. 
Q: It's been 25 years, but do you still have the desire to be a wrestler? 
MARUFUJI: What did you think of what you saw today? Marufuji: If you think you can do a little more, I'd like you to do a little more. Even though I've been living on the very edge, but living on the edge is fun. If you do what you can at the last minute, the audience will be happy to see it. There are people in the media who have known me for 25 years, and I want to continue doing my best with Noah.
